Output e3b578b2c0eecbb8c8117432154e962dfae7e62c1b247055d10c900fc43617de:0

value
1586184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812124c9b7fd22b9b4d5520c2942cb648f4a0688 OP_EQUAL
address
3DTno9vmx8piVBfKAhRACVedkR4ccs9AoQ
transaction
e3b578b2c0eecbb8c8117432154e962dfae7e62c1b247055d10c900fc43617de
spent
true